Each month, the talented Doan sisters demonstrate three new Dashing Star, or LeMoyne star, quilt patterns. In this episode, the talented Doan sisters demonstrate three new Dashing Star, or LeMoyne star,quilt patterns.
Natalie’s Scattered Shoofly Stars is a modern masterwork with oversized lemons stars and fancy shoofly trim. Her fabric is Daisy Fields 10″ Stackers by Beverly McCullough of Flamingo Toes for Riley Blake.
Misty’s Star Dancer has two sizes of stars. She creates a huge number of tiny stars using the simple 16 method for making speedy half-square triangles. Her fabric is the Country Rose Layer Cake by Lella Boutique for Moda Fabrics.
